Carrollian Amplitudes, Celestial Symmetries and Twistor Space

Romain Ruzziconi (U Oxford)

Apr 24. 2024, 09:30 — 10:00

Carrollian amplitudes are massless scattering amplitudes expressed in position space at null infinity. These are to be re-interpreted as correlation functions in a putative dual Carrollian CFT. I will discuss the properties of Carrollian amplitudes and their relations with celestial amplitudes. I will explain how the collinear limit unveils a notion of Carrollian OPE and deduce the action of celestial symmetries at null infinity. Finally, I will present a direct connection between twistor space and Carrollian amplitudes.
